Meeting notes (excerpt) — Fieldwork logistics, Thornvale office

Discussed the locked case of Hexley T-40 test devices currently held in the secure cupboard. All eight units are accounted for and the case remains sealed since the last audit. Collection by Pellan Transit is set for Friday; the coordinator will brief the assigned driver beforehand. When the driver arrives, the coordinator must pass on the hand-over instruction recorded below.

drop instructions, yafog-yawip: the quenmir olidor courier leaves the julox tamion keliel ledger at gate 5283 under passcode 336825

## Runbook: Tilecrumb Cache Rollout

Hey support folks — quick fragment for the Tilecrumb release. After deploy, the tile-rendering cache warms itself over ~20 minutes, so expect slow map loads early on. Don't panic, don't flush anything. If customers report stale tiles after an hour, escalate to platform. Deploys must be signed; here's the key.

rollout seal: bky9_PeXH1fTLY

# Gridsmith crossword generator — env file.
# Reviewed quarterly. No defaults baked into the image; everything is injected here.
# Vars above this block: dictionary path, grid size limits, cache TTL. All non-sensitive.
# The generator calls the clue-scoring service over mutual TLS; rotation handled by the platform team.
# One secret lives in this file for the scoring API. Audit scope ends at this line; the credential entry follows immediately below:

sealed setting: ARCHIVE_KEY3=8d0

Finance Review Summary — Training Budget, Next Fiscal Year

Prepared for the heads of department. The proposed training allocation rises eight percent, driven mainly by the Larkspur certification program and expanded onboarding at the Dunmere site. Travel-linked training is trimmed in favor of facilitated remote cohorts. Department caps remain unchanged pending the December review. Please weigh your requests against the strategic direction noted confidentially below.

confidential, tagep-yahag: Headcount on the Oliael team goes from 5 to 100 by the end of July. Gross margin on Oliael came in at 20 percent against a plan of 15 percent.